Describe the issue
Brightness control are not working on my Samsung LF32TU87.
Software dimming does works but not hardware dimming.
Expected behavior
Brightness control change the brightness hardware value of my Samsung LF32TU87.

@gagarine commented on GitHub (Jan 15, 2023):
Their is another issue for this monitor https://github.com/MonitorControl/MonitorControl/issues/1042 but no one mentionnes a problem with hardware dimming. Actually it seams to works for peoples (but perhaps it was only the software dimming without realizing it didn't works)
@gagarine commented on GitHub (Jan 18, 2023):
The problem is not with monitorcontrol. It's because brightness control is disable with "eco mode" is on. Disabling the eco mode solve the problem.
@willxie commented on GitHub (Feb 10, 2023):
I have the same monitor with M1 MBP16" and the same issue. Disabling "Eco Saving Plus" mode unlocks OSD brightness settings. However, monitorcontrol cannot adjust the brightness for this monitor still. The brightness bar would show up but noop to the screen and real settings. @gagarine Could you share more on how you fixed this?
@gagarine commented on GitHub (Feb 12, 2023):
It works for a moment... and then it failed again. I need to investigate to understand what's the problem.
@waydabber commented on GitHub (Feb 16, 2023):
I'll move this to discussions as it is a valid, but display specific issue which cannot be solved by changing how MonitorControl works.
